WebPanchayats in the Mughal society: (i) The village panchayat was an assembly of elders, usually important people of the village with hereditary rights over their property. (ii) In mixed-caste villages, the panchayat was usually a heterogeneous body. (iii) The decisions made by these panchayats were binding on the members.
